i am so proud of this rifle, i cant wait to take it out to the range and try it out!  this was my first lower assembly, and i got it together and it clicks and resets as expected.

im into this rifle for about $550 so far.  (ETA - NOPE... see below)






i got the lower in the summer time when they had the $250 deal for a lower and 10 pmags (so i justify about 119 of the $550 for that).  i got the upper for black friday sale for 270, and the BCG for 109. the handle is a "colt" from ebay (hopefully a colt, at least ), and the charging handle i already had.

cant wait to take this KISS carbine out and get it scuffed up!

ETA: requested: parts/price list

lower: $119, PSA M4
upper: $269, PSA upper kit (no BCG no CH), 1/7 CL HF barrel, supposedly made by FN?
lower parts kit: $50ish, a bag of parts off the wall at Gun Masters in Plano, TX
BCG: PSA, $109
Carry Handle: Colt (supposedly, hopefully?), $55, used from Ebay.
Charging handle and 4 position Stock, i already had.  

OK so my math is terrible.  because thats $602.

there have been better sales, and other options since i bought this kit.  the upper kit could have been as low as $179 from PSA.com.  OR, the same Upper with BCG and CH (Blem) could be had for $359 now.  the single stripped lower could have been $49 (Blem).  with the PTAC upper and the blem lower, you could be starting at $239 before BCG/CH/Parts kit.
